One of the primary types of control arms is the wishbone control arm, also known as the A-arm. Found primarily in front-wheel-drive vehicles, the wishbone control arm resembles the letter 'A' or a wishbone, providing a stable linkage between the vehicle frame and the wheel hub. This design is advantageous for its hefty load-bearing capacity and ability to maintain wheel alignment, contributing to the vehicle's agility and handling precision. Another prevalent type is the multi-link control arm, which consists of multiple arms and joints. This complex system offers superior flexibility compared to other designs, making it a popular choice for high-performance and luxury vehicles. The multi-link system enhances cornering stability and ride comfort by allowing individual adjustments, which is particularly beneficial when navigating uneven surfaces. Its sophisticated design, however, necessitates expert installation and periodic maintenance to uphold its performance.

MacPherson struts, although primarily a type of suspension system, often incorporate a form of control arm to connect to the vehicle's body. This system is notably compact, making it ideal for smaller vehicles where space efficiency is a priority. MacPherson struts afford a balance between cost-effectiveness and performance, offering a straightforward yet reliable solution without sacrificing ride quality.control arm types
Trailing arm suspension systems are frequently used in the rear suspension of vehicles. The trailing arm's principal function is to manage the rear axle's movement, which is crucial for maintaining stability during acceleration and braking. Though simpler and less costly than other designs, trailing arms deliver dependable performance, particularly in off-road and heavy-duty applications. Control arms are constructed from various materials, including stamped steel, aluminum, and forged steel. Stamped steel control arms are the most common, offering a practical balance of strength and affordability. In contrast, aluminum control arms are lighter, reducing unsprung weight and improving vehicle responsiveness, although they come at a higher cost. Forged steel arms are reputed for their exceptional durability, ready to withstand the rigorous demands of high-performance driving.
